What Are the Benefits of Using Dumbbells for Home Workouts?
The benefits of using dumbbells for home workouts include increased strength, improved coordination, and enhanced workout variety.
- Increased Strength
- Improved Coordination
- Enhanced Workout Variety
- Better Muscle Engagement
- Flexibility in Workout Routines
Using dumbbells for home workouts provides numerous advantages, and understanding each benefit can help individuals maximize their fitness routines.
-
Increased Strength:
Using dumbbells increases strength by requiring users to lift weights that challenge their muscles. Resistance training with dumbbells enhances muscle fiber recruitment, leading to greater strength gains. A study by Schoenfeld (2010) suggests that lifting weights results in increased muscle hypertrophy, or size. For example, performing a bicep curl with a dumbbell targets the bicep muscle specifically. -
Improved Coordination:
Improved coordination develops through the stabilization required while using dumbbells. Unlike machines that guide movements, dumbbells require the user to control their motions. This engages smaller stabilizing muscles, which enhances overall coordination. In a paper published by Behm and Anderson (2006), researchers found that free weights improve neuromuscular coordination compared to machine-based training. -
Enhanced Workout Variety:
Dumbbells offer a variety of exercises that target different muscle groups. Users can easily modify the weight and change exercises to keep their routines fresh. For instance, an individual can perform shoulder presses, lunges, and tricep extensions with a single pair. The versatility of dumbbells allows for creative workout designs, leading to reduced workout monotony. -
Better Muscle Engagement:
Better muscle engagement occurs when using dumbbells due to their free-form motion, which can activate more muscle fibers than machines. According to a study by Sato et al. (2012), individuals using dumbbells experience heightened muscle activation in exercises like the squat when compared to resistance machines. This leads to overall better muscular development. -
Flexibility in Workout Routines:
Flexibility in workout routines is enhanced because dumbbells can be used for various workouts targeting strength, endurance, and hypertrophy. Users can perform compound movements or isolation exercises. This flexibility allows individuals to tailor their workouts to their goals and fitness levels, making it easier to adapt over time.
Which Features Are Essential in Selecting Adjustable Dumbbells?
When selecting adjustable dumbbells, several essential features should be considered:
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Weight Range | The range of weights the dumbbells can adjust to, allowing for progression in your workouts. |
| Adjustment Mechanism | The ease and speed of changing weights, which can include dial systems, pin systems, or lever systems. |
| Space Efficiency | How compact the dumbbell system is, especially important for home gyms with limited space. |
| Durability | Materials and build quality that ensure the dumbbells can withstand regular use without degrading. |
| Grip Comfort | The design of the handle for comfort during use, which can affect workout performance. |
| Price | Cost-effectiveness compared to traditional dumbbells and other adjustable options. |
| Brand Reputation | The reliability and customer support of the brand manufacturing the dumbbells. |
| Weight Increments | The smallest weight increase available when adjusting the dumbbells, which can affect workout progression. |
| Safety Features | Any mechanisms that prevent weights from loosening or falling during use, ensuring user safety. |
How Important Are Dumbbell Materials for Durability and Performance?
Dumbbell materials are crucial for durability and performance. The main materials include steel, cast iron, rubber, and vinyl. Each material has distinct properties impacting their use.
Steel dumbbells are robust and resist wear. They handle heavy weights well. Cast iron dumbbells are also strong and resist bending. However, they can rust if exposed to moisture.
Rubber-coated dumbbells offer a protective layer. This layer prevents damage to flooring and reduces noise. Vinyl dumbbells are lighter and suitable for beginners or rehabilitation. They easily accommodate various weight levels.
Durability relies on the material strength. Strong materials withstand repeated use and impact. Performance links to how the materials affect grip and comfort during exercises.
Choosing the right material influences exercising habits. For example, beginners may prefer vinyl or rubber for ease of use. Experienced users might opt for steel or cast iron for intensity.
In summary, the choice of dumbbell material affects both longevity and exercise effectiveness. This decision impacts individual training experiences.
What Mechanisms Do Adjustable Dumbbells Use for Weight Adjustments?
Adjustable dumbbells use several mechanisms for weight adjustments, primarily designed for convenience and efficiency. Common mechanisms include:
| Mechanism | Description | Advantages |
|---|---|---|
| Selector Pin Mechanism | Uses a pin that locks into place to select desired weights, allowing quick changes between exercises. | Quick adjustments, user-friendly. |
| Dial or Knob Mechanism | Involves turning a dial or knob to adjust weights, often integrated into the dumbbell’s design for smooth transitions. | Smooth transitions, compact design. |
| Plate System | Includes individual weight plates that can be added or removed manually, typically secured with clips or levers. | Customizable weight options, often more economical. |
| Magnetic Mechanism | Utilizes magnets to hold weights in place, allowing quick adjustments by simply sliding the weights on or off. | Fast changes, minimal effort. |
Each mechanism has its advantages in terms of ease of use, speed of adjustments, and compactness.

What Safety Precautions Should You Take When Using Dumbbells at Home?
When using dumbbells at home, it is essential to take several safety precautions to prevent injuries and ensure effective workouts.
- Choose appropriate weights.
- Maintain proper form.
- Use a stable surface.
- Wear suitable footwear.
- Warm up before exercising.
- Avoid distractions.
- Store dumbbells safely when not in use.
To elaborate, these precautions can significantly enhance your safety and effectiveness during workouts.
-
Choose Appropriate Weights: Choosing appropriate weights means selecting dumbbells that match your fitness level. If the weights are too heavy, they can lead to strain or injury. Start with lighter weights and gradually increase as you build strength. A study by the American Council on Exercise suggests beginners should consider weights that allow them to perform 8-12 repetitions with good form.
-
Maintain Proper Form: Maintaining proper form involves using correct posture and technique when lifting dumbbells. Poor form can lead to injuries, particularly in the back and shoulders. According to a 2021 report by the National Strength and Conditioning Association, proper alignment helps to engage the target muscles effectively. Videos or instruction from certified trainers can provide guidance on form.
-
Use a Stable Surface: Using a stable surface means exercising on a flat and non-slip floor. This reduces the risk of losing balance and dropping weights. Research published in the Journal of Strength and Conditioning Research emphasizes that a steady base is vital for safety during strength training. Consider using a yoga mat for added grip and cushioning.
-
Wear Suitable Footwear: Wearing suitable footwear refers to choosing supportive shoes that provide grip and stability. Athletic shoes with cushioning and good traction can help prevent slips and falls. According to the American Footwear Association, proper footwear can significantly influence your posture and stability during strength exercises.
-
Warm Up Before Exercising: Warming up before exercising involves engaging in light, dynamic activities to prepare your muscles. This practice increases blood flow and reduces the risk of injury.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ention recommend 5-10 minutes of warm-up before any strength training to enhance performance and flexibility.
-
Avoid Distractions: Avoiding distractions means focusing fully on your workout without interruptions from phones or television. Distractions can lead to loss of concentration and increase the risk of accidents. According to a 2019 study in the Journal of Applied Psychology, focused training is linked to better results and safer workouts.
-
Store Dumbbells Safely When Not in Use: Storing dumbbells safely refers to keeping them in a designated area where they will not pose a tripping hazard. Leaving weights on the floor can lead to accidents. The Fitness Industry Association recommends using a rack or shelf to store weights securely and neatly, ensuring the workout area remains safe.
How Can You Create an Effective At-Home Workout Routine with Dumbbells?
To create an effective at-home workout routine with dumbbells, prioritize the following key elements: set clear fitness goals, select appropriate exercises, establish a balanced schedule, ensure proper form, and progressively increase weights.
Setting clear fitness goals: Define what you want to achieve. Possible goals include building strength, improving endurance, or losing weight. Research by the American College of Sports Medicine (2016) highlights that specific goals enhance motivation and adherence to exercise.
Selecting appropriate exercises: Choose a mix of exercises targeting major muscle groups. Include movements like bicep curls, tricep extensions, goblet squats, and shoulder presses. According to a study in the Journal of Strength and Conditioning Research (2018), compound movements engage multiple muscle groups simultaneously, making workouts more efficient.
Establishing a balanced schedule: Create a workout routine that includes both strength training and cardiovascular activities. For example, aim for three strength sessions and two cardio sessions per week.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ention recommends at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ity cardio weekly alongside strength training.
Ensuring proper form: Focus on maintaining correct technique to prevent injuries. Use mirrors or video recordings to check your posture. A study in the Journal of Physical Therapy Science (2019) indicated that proper form during strength training significantly reduces the risk of injuries and improves effectiveness.
Progressively increasing weights: Gradually increase the weight of the dumbbells as you build strength. This principle, known as progressive overload, helps stimulate muscle growth and adaptation. Health and fitness expert Brad Schoenfeld (2010) explains that lifting heavier weights over time triggers increased muscle hypertrophy, leading to improved strength and endurance.
By addressing these elements, you can create an effective at-home workout routine that fosters health and fitness improvement.
